Barcelona wishes to sign Silva for turning the game in their favor in premier league summers

According to journalist Fabrizio Romano, Barcelona is seriously wondering about signing Silva this summer. He is a desirable player for both Xavi and Deco, the sporting director. While specific signing intentions remain unidentified, one player that Xavi and Deco wish to sign this summer is Manchester City’s Bernardo Silva.

They believe he may be an important factor and lift the team’s performance to another level, allowing them to qualify for the prestigious Champions League title. However, the operation is instead complex. Barcelona has been dealing with financial troubles for some years and will need to wait for the outcome of their Financial Competition confusion before moving further

The Catalan soccer team is focusing on key positions while also looking to reinforce other areas such as the central ground of the field, left wing, and fullback. Fortunately for the Catalans, unlike their past experiences and efforts to sign Bernardo Silva in recent years, his transfer fee this summer will be €58 million (£50 million) due to a provision for release in his contract.

Furthermore, while the player prefers a move to Barcelona, as revealed by Joao Felix, the funds are mostly intended to acquire a turning point, with Martin Zubimendi and Joshua Kimmich emerging as key competitors on the wish list for appropriate additional elements.

According to reports, Barcelona has approached Real Betis’ Guido Rodriguez about a potential free transfer move this summer, although no significant movement has been made. If that move gets across, the people of Barcelona could potentially be capable of raising sufficient cash to make an offer that is serious for Bernardo. However, until then, the operation appears unattainable.
